How do you split a polygon in QGIS?
Split a polygon feature with a digitized line in QGIS
- Start QGIS 2.0.
- Select View | Toolbars.
- In the Layers pane, select the polygon layer.
- Click the Split Feature icon.
- Digitize a line over a polygon feature.
- Right click to complete the line.
- To make the change permanent, toggle off Editing mode.
How do I cut a line in QGIS?
To trim a line, you could simply use the ‘split features’ tool. To extend, you have two choices: create a new line and merge both or use the node tool to drag the endpoint to your desired location. I found CadInput plugin [1] helpful in extending (parallel mode) and making a fillet.
How do I join lines in QGIS?
Join 2 lines in QGIS
- If the Join Lines plug-in is not installed, select Plug-ins | Manage and install plug-ins and install the Join Lines plug-in.
- In the map view, select two lines.
- Select Vector | Join two lines | Join two lines.
- Select Layer | Toggle editing.
- Click Save. The joined line is saved.
How do you draw a boundary in Qgis?
To create a new boundary, you need to first create a vector layer. 1> Select Layer > Create Layer > New Shapefile Layer. Use the Add Feature to create polygons. When you draw a polygon, it will prompt you to enter an id which will be stored as an attribute.
How do you capture a line in QGIS?
Click a set of points along the line. RIGHT click when you have reached the final point to finish, and choose a name for the line feature. Click on Toggle editing to save the vector line layer. For capturing polygons Click on the Capture Polygon button. Click a set of points along the perimeter of the polygon.
